Storm Shutters Installation Questions
What types of storm shutters are available for installation? Common options include roll-down, accordion, Bahama, and storm panels, each offering different levels of protection and convenience.
How do storm shutters improve property safety? They provide a barrier against high winds, flying debris, and hail, helping to protect windows and reduce potential damage during storms.
Are storm shutters suitable for all types of properties? Yes, they can be installed on homes, commercial buildings, and other structures to enhance storm readiness.
What should property owners consider before installing storm shutters? It’s important to evaluate the property's architecture, window types, and specific storm risks to choose the most effective shutter system.
